Let’s talk about collagen – the most abundant protein in the body. It’s what gives your skin, muscles, bones, tissues, and other ligaments the strength and support they need to function properly. Collagen is hard at work everywhere you go – helping you look and feel younger, healthier, happier, and more radiant.
That’s all well and good, but collagen is a lot like an iPhone – in the sense that it isn’t built to last forever. Collagen levels tend to peak in our early- to mid-20s, but something happens by the time we turn 30 – collagen levels start to decline, and our existing collagen starts to break down at a much more rapid rate.

By now, you may or may not have heard of Forma RF. It’s a revolutionary skin-tightening treatment that utilizes radiofrequency (RF) technology to rejuvenate, revive, restore, and revitalize the skin. The device was launched by InMode – the same state-of-the-art company that brought us the Morpheus8 device.
So, how does Forma RF work? The RF device utilizes safe levels of low-frequency electromagnetic waves to gently heat the deeper layers of the skin. This triggers the body’s natural healing process, which stimulates collagen production and sends it to the scene – tightening, firming, and regenerating the skin.

Forma RF, also known as the ‘Red Carpet Facial,’ is a non-invasive procedure that takes anywhere between 30 minutes and a full hour. Most people notice a difference after the first treatment, but results can take several weeks to truly show. With more collagen, your skin can finally take a deep breath again.
